S.I. No. 50/1946 - Unemployment Assistance (Employment Period) Order, 1946.


STATUTORY RULES AND ORDERS. 1946. No. 50.

UNEMPLOYMENT ASSISTANCE (EMPLOYMENT PERIOD) ORDER, 1946.

The Minister for Industry and Commerce in exercise of the powers conferred on him by subsection (3) of section 4 and subsection (1) of section 7 of the Unemployment Assistance Act, 1933 (No. 46 of 1933), and of every and any other power him in this behalf enabling hereby orders as follows, that is to say :

1. This Order may be cited as the Unemployment Assistance (Employment Period) Order, 1946.

2. The Interpretation Act, 1937 (No. 38 of 1937), applies to this Order.

3. The following regulations shall have effect for the purposes of subsection (3) of section 4 of the Unemployment Assistance Act, 1933 (No. 46 of 1933), that is to say :—

I. The period commencing on the 6th day of March, 1946, and ending on the 22nd day of October, 1946, shall be an employment period in respect of the following class of persons, namely, every person

(a) whose place of residence is not situate within any county or other borough, urban district or town, and

(b) who is the occupier of land of which the rateable valuation or the aggregate rateable valuations exceeds or exceed £2, and

(c) who is not enrolled in the Special Register of Agricultural and Turf Workers kept under the Emergency Powers (No. 243) Order, 1942 (S. R. & O., No. 503 of 1942).

II. For the purposes of these Regulations—

(a) the word " land " means land entered as such in the valuation list, within the meaning of the Valuation Acts ;

(b) land let for depasturage for a period of less than one year shall be deemed to be occupied by the person who was the occupier thereof immediately before such letting.
